Ed Hardy

Thursday, March 14, 2013

Europe' s window of opportunity

At Oknoplast's production site outside Krakow, Poland, windows of all shapes and sizes are stacked up ready for del ... http://bit.ly/Z1p0mc

No comments:

Post a Comment